Don't Forget to prune these 10 fruit trees in early spring.

Apples

If you want more fruit from your apple tree, trim it in early spring. All of the thousands of apple tree cultivars benefit from annual pruning for the best fruit. Dormancy begins when apple trees lose their leaves after harvest. Don't prune until winter's worst is over to avoid frost or ice damage.

Figs

To prevent branch overgrowth and suckers, fig trees need pruning. Only in early spring, during dormancy, should heavy trimming be done. April is a good month to chop fig trees because most are dormant. Tree pruning involves removing damaged or dead branches and trimming the tree.

Pears

Regular trimming trains pears for fruit output. Pruning pears is similar to apple pruning. Continue pruning your tree in early spring every year following planting. How much pruning you do depends on summer growth. Older trees may need heavier trimming to remove old wood.

Plums

For young plum trees, April is the optimal time to prune. Midsummer pruning of healthy plum trees controls their strong development. Early spring will promote strong growth in its early years. Plums are pruned similarly to apple trees.

Cherries

Sweet and sour cherry trees are planted in the U.S. Winter harm can be avoided by pruning both varieties of cherries in early spring. The tree should be dormant. Summer pruning can shrink trees.

Peaches

Summer trimming is used to reduce shade and improve fruit quality in peach trees. However, excessive summer pruning might stunt younger trees.

Nectarines

Like peaches, nectarines are stone fruit trees that bear fruit on one-year-old wood. Like peach trees, nectarines should be pruned early spring. Avoid pruning fruit trees in early winter, which raises the risk of serious illnesses.

Pomegranates

Pomegranates need more pruning while young to grow into trees. Young trees need lighter trimming, but mature trees can benefit from stronger pruning for fruit output. Young trees should be pruned before blooming in spring.

Apricots

Prune newly planted apricot trees in early spring. Older, established trees can easily prune interior shoots in summer. To minimize serious infections, including bacterial canker, early spring trimming is best.

Persimmons

Persimmon trees are one of the cheapest tree species and produce good fruit with little upkeep. Persimmon trees are easy to prune in early spring when they are dormant and sap is not running.
